Dunkin' VP of Sales Salaries in Los Angeles

The average Dunkin' VP of Sales in Los Angeles earns an estimated $241,849 annually, which includes an estimated base salary of $201,849 with a $40,000 bonus. Dunkin' VP of Sales compensation is $2,394,348 less than the US average for a VP of Sales. VP of Sales salaries at Dunkin' in Los Angeles can range from $175,000 - $260,000.

In Los Angeles, The Sales Department at Dunkin' earns $2,155 more on average than the IT Department.
